Types of Drainage Pipes

Drainage systems play a vital role in maintaining urban hygiene, preventing waterlogging, and managing wastewater effectively. Over the years, the types of drainage pipes used in infrastructure projects have evolved significantly—shifting from conventional methods to more advanced, durable, and efficient technologies.

Traditionally, open drainage systems were common, especially in semi-urban and rural areas. While economical, they often became breeding grounds for mosquitoes and posed serious hygiene issues due to foul Odors, blockages, and contamination. As cities expanded, the demand for long-lasting, low-maintenance, and enclosed drainage systems grew stronger.

This led to the adoption of cement and asbestos cement pipes reinforced with wire, which offered greater strength. However, these options were still prone to cracks and leakages. Over time, the industry shifted toward advanced solutions like UGD (Underground Drainage) PVC Pipes and DWC (Double Wall Corrugated) Pipes, which are now widely recognized as smart and sustainable alternatives.

Reinforced Cement Concrete (RCC) Pipes – Aging and Inefficient

RCC pipes have long been used in stormwater and sewage applications due to their structural strength. However, these pipes are heavy, difficult to install, and susceptible to cracking from ground shifts. The joints are also prone to leakage, which compromises their effectiveness over time.

With growing demands for infrastructure efficiency and ease of installation, RCC pipes are increasingly being replaced by lighter and more reliable alternatives.

UGD Pipes – Ideal for Compact Drainage Solutions

UGD (Underground Drainage) pipes made of uPVC are a smart, modern alternative to traditional drainage systems. Ideal for small diameters (110mm to 200mm), they are used in homes, buildings, layouts and municipal projects. Through UGD Pipes – individual house waste/ water is piped out to the main drainage line of the municipal corporation.

DWC Pipes – Robust Sewerage Infrastructure

DWC (Double Wall Corrugated) pipes are used for large underground drainage and sewerage systems, especially in cities. They have a smooth inner wall for fast water flow and a strong outer layer to handle heavy loads. Commonly used in municipal sewers, stormwater drains, and industrial waste lines, they come in sizes from 150mm to 1200mm.

DWC pipes are a modern, cost-effective solution for urban drainage needs. Cost-wise wise DWC Pipes are much cheaper than higher Dia RCC Pipes, easy rubber jointing, No Leakage, and easy installation.

DWC Pipe is connected with the Individual House wastewater line with PVC UGD (Underground Drainage Pipe).

Cast Iron Pipes – Traditional Yet Trusted

Cast iron pipes, though more expensive and heavier than newer alternatives, are still used in select municipal and commercial projects due to their unmatched strength and lifespan. Their corrosion-resistant nature and load-bearing capacity make them suitable for heavy-duty applications.

However, due to high costs and challenging installation, they are now less favoured in modern projects.
